A member asked:

What would cause extensive purple lacy rash on arms/ legs when cold over past few months , goes away once warm? not raised or itchy?

There are several possible causes of a purple lacy rash on the arms and legs that appears when exposed to cold temperatures and disappears once warm. This condition is known as livedo reticularis, which is a skin condition characterized by a mottled or lace-like appearance of the skin. One possible cause of livedo reticularis is Raynaud's phenomenon, or an autoimmune disorder.
